About SeaWorld Entertainment, Inc.

SeaWorld Entertainment, Inc. is a theme park and entertainment company that operates marine mammal parks, oceanariums, animal theme parks, and water parks. The company owns and operates twelve parks located across the United States. SeaWorld parks feature live entertainment, rides, and animal exhibits. The company is also involved in conservation efforts and animal rescue operations. SeaWorld Entertainment, Inc. was founded in 1959 and is headquartered in Orlando, Florida.
